Frequently Asked Questions about Rugby

How much are Studio apartments in Rugby?

There are currently 9 Studio Apartments in Rugby with rent ranges from $500 to $1,746 with an average price of $964.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Rugby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Rugby ranges from $700 to $3,500 with an average monthly rent of $1,224.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Rugby c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Rugby range from $532 to $2,500.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,214.

How expensive are Rugby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 22 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Rugby on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$613 to $2,225 - averaging $1,411 for the location.
